Soft wax is a type of hair removal wax that adheres to both the hair and the skin, making it ideal for removing fine to medium hair. Unlike hard wax, which hardens and is removed without strips, soft wax requires the use of wax strips to pull the hair from the root. This makes it perfect for larger areas like legs, arms, and backs. But before you start waxing away, there are a few key steps to ensure a smooth and painless experience for your clients.
What Makes Soft Wax Special?
Soft wax is known for its ability to remove even the finest hairs, leaving the skin silky smooth. It's typically applied in a thin layer using a wax spatula, and then removed with a cloth or paper strip. The wax grips the hair tightly, ensuring that it's pulled out from the root, which means longer-lasting results compared to shaving. Plus, regular waxing can lead to finer and sparser hair growth over time—bonus!
How to Use Soft Wax Like a Pro
Ready to become a soft wax wizard? Follow these steps to ensure a flawless waxing experience:
- Prep the Skin: Cleanse the area thoroughly to remove any oils, lotions, or makeup. You can use a pre-wax cleanser to ensure the skin is ready for waxing.
- Heat the Wax: Use a wax warmer to heat the soft wax to the perfect temperature—warm but not hot. Test it on your wrist to avoid burns.
- Apply the Wax: Using a spatula, apply the wax in the direction of hair growth. Keep the layer thin and even for the best results.
- Place the Strip: Press a wax strip firmly over the wax, smoothing it down in the direction of hair growth.
- Remove the Strip: Hold the skin taut with one hand and quickly pull the strip in the opposite direction of hair growth. Pro tip: Pull parallel to the skin to minimize discomfort.
- Post-Wax Care: Soothe the skin with a post-wax lotion or oil to reduce redness and irritation.
